Output 34a48fbdacb0815d870a4170c31a0a1c1dd7501396d05dec92d0a625da047406:80

value
269218
script pubkey
OP_0 OP_PUSHBYTES_20 82f50efa2c1a4cb0f522a10cd58174a0ac73e093
address
bc1qst6sa73vrfxtpafz5yxdtqt55zk88cyn3ezldd
transaction
34a48fbdacb0815d870a4170c31a0a1c1dd7501396d05dec92d0a625da047406
confirmations
9074
spent
true